Eastern Florida State to host 2024 DI Women's Golf Championship
Eastern Florida State will host the six-day national tournament at the Duran Golf Club in Melbourne, FL, from May 19-24, 2024.
"We are excited to host the NJCAA DI Women's Golf Championship at Duran this spring," said Jeff Carr, Associate Vice President of Athletics at Eastern Florida State. "It is a testament to Jamie Howell and his staff for the great National Championships that we have hosted in the past here in Brevard County. The vision of our President Dr. Jim Richey and Vice President Jack Parker to host National Championship events which gives back to our community with significant economic impact and having the opportunity to watch some of the top women's golfers in the country is very exciting!"
Eastern Florida State previously hosted the NJCAA DI Men's Golf Championship in 2019 at the Duran Golf Club.
"The NJCAA is excited to bring the DI Women's Golf Championship to Melbourne," stated Brian Luckett, NJCAA Senior Vice President for External Affairs & Development. "Eastern Florida State has previously hosted multiple championships for our organization, and we look forward to seeing how they develop this one."
The Titans have also previously hosted the Division I Women's Soccer Championship eight times and in 2022 hosted the Division I Men's Soccer Championship.
